Environmental Studies
● OpenEnvironmental Studies at Stony Brook University in New York provides students with the skills and knowledge necessary to tackle complex environmental issues. Led by Faculty Director Dr. Tara Rider, the program offers a Bachelor of Arts degree with a curriculum that is interdisciplinary, integrating principles from various fields. Students can choose from concentrations such as Conservation Biology/Biological Anthropology, Marine Science, Marine or Terrestrial Ecology, or Environmental Law, Waste Management, and Public Policy. The program also includes opportunities for research, internships, and field studies to gain real-world experience and network with professionals in the field.

Advanced Energy Center (AERTC)
● OpenThe Advanced Energy Center (AERTC) is a cutting-edge institution located at Stony Brook University in New York. The center is a collaborative effort between academic and research institutions, energy providers, and industrial corporations, with a focus on innovative energy research, education, and technology deployment. AERTC specializes in efficiency, conservation, renewable energy, and nanotechnology applications for new and novel sources of energy. The center has strong partnerships with various New York State Centers of Excellence, Centers of Advanced Technologies, universities, colleges, and industrial and federal laboratories. AERTC is at the forefront of advancing sustainable energy solutions and is dedicated to shaping the future of the energy industry.

Marine and Atmospheric Sciences Information Center
● OpenWelcome to the Marine and Atmospheric Sciences Information Center (MASIC), your gateway to cutting-edge knowledge and research resources in marine and atmospheric sciences. Located in Challenger Hall on the Stony Brook University South Campus, New York, MASIC is a state-of-the-art library designed to serve as a modern prototype for future knowledge centers. At MASIC, we offer an extensive collection of vital resources, including core journals in marine and atmospheric sciences, comprehensive monographs, essential reprints, and a valuable collection of SoMAS master's theses and doctoral dissertations. Our holdings also include MSRC Special Reports, Technical Reports, nautical charts, maps, and a broad general science reference collection, ensuring that students, researchers, and professionals have access to the information they need.

LL Cool J Statue - The G.O.A.T. Monument
● ClosedWelcome to the LL Cool J Statue - The G.O.A.T. Monument, a unique tourist attraction located at 97 Main Street, Stony Brook, New York 11790. Nestled within the Long Island Music & Entertainment Hall of Fame Museum, this sculptural sonic monument is a tribute to the legendary Queens hip-hop icon, LL Cool J. Originally displayed in Flushing Meadows Corona Park, Queens, NYC, the monument celebrates LL Cool J's profound impact on the music industry and his roots in Queens. Crafted from materials like bronze, resin, stainless steel, and wood, the monument is not just a visual masterpiece but also an auditory experience. Equipped with audio and lighting systems powered by solar energy, it plays a curated selection of LL Cool J's iconic tracks, which evolve over time to feature favorites chosen by DJs, friends, and fans.
